{"id":3184,"date":"2024-06-24T11:15:16","date_gmt":"2024-06-24T11:15:16","guid":{"rendered":"https:\/\/usf.wp-kundenseite.at\/produkte-und-markte\/edi-vnx-series\/"},"modified":"2026-01-09T13:11:00","modified_gmt":"2026-01-09T13:11:00","slug":"edi-vnx-series","status":"publish","type":"produkte-und-markte","link":"https:\/\/usf.wp-kundenseite.at\/en\/produkte-und-markte\/cedi-technology\/edi-vnx-series\/","title":{"rendered":"EDI-VNX Series"},"content":{"rendered":"\n<p class=\"wp-block-paragraph\">The VNX module is designed to reduce the cost of building high-throughput EDI systems and represents a simple, clean, and environmentally friendly technology compared to chemically regenerated mixed bed ion exchange systems. This new and unique technology reduces the number of modules, simplifying the piping and assembly of the systems, thereby making it more cost-effective. <\/p>\n\n<p class=\"wp-block-paragraph\">In both LX and VNX modules, the spacers are stacked in a conventional plate and frame arrangement, with the product and concentrate spacers alternating. This configuration provides a more even distribution of flow and current than other configurations (such as spiral wound modules). This property is very important for the performance and longevity of the module.  <\/p>\n\n<h2 class=\"wp-block-heading\"><strong>VNX28EP-2 and VNX55EP-2 Module<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The VNX-EP module series was developed as a successor to the VNX50-3 and VNX28-2 modules for high flow rates.<\/p>\n\n<h3 class=\"wp-block-heading\">Product highlights:<\/h3>\n\n<ul class=\"wp-block-list\">\n<li>Optimal for applications with high flow rates (e.g. power plant sector)<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>High pressure resistance (7 bar) at max. 45\u00b0C continuous operation <\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Very compact design<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Cost savings through chemical-free process<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Low maintenance costs<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Each module is supplied with 4 PVC 1.5\u2033 connection adapters<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\"><\/p>\n\n<p class=\"wp-block-paragraph\"><a href=\"http:\/\/usf-water.com\/wp-content\/uploads\/2017\/03\/DB-VNXEP.pdf\" target=\"_blank\" rel=\"noreferrer noopener\">Data sheet<\/a><\/p>\n\n<h2 class=\"wp-block-heading\"><strong>VNX55-HH Module<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The VNX55-HH module was specifically developed for applications with a higher hardness feed.<\/p>\n\n<h3 class=\"wp-block-heading\">Product highlights:<\/h3>\n\n<ul class=\"wp-block-list\">\n<li>Max. hardness feed: 2 ppm (as CaCO3) <\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Design flow rate: 9.1 m<sup>3<\/sup>\/h<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Optimal for applications with high flow rates (e.g. power plant sector)<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Water yield: 80\u201390%<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Silicate removal: &gt; 90%<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Sodium and chloride removal: \u2265 99.5%<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Module design optimized for higher hardness tolerance<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Robust, guaranteed leakage-free operation<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Very compact design<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Cost savings through chemical-free process<\/li>\n<\/ul>\n\n<ul class=\"wp-block-list\">\n<li>Low maintenance costs<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\"><\/p>\n\n<p class=\"wp-block-paragraph\"><a href=\"http:\/\/usf-water.com\/wp-content\/uploads\/2017\/03\/DB-VNX55HH.pdf\" target=\"_blank\" rel=\"noreferrer noopener\">Data sheet<\/a><\/p>\n\n<h2 class=\"wp-block-heading\"><strong>VNX15CDIT and VNX30-CDIT Module<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The VNX-CDIT module series was specifically developed for applications with a higher hardness feed and higher feed conductivity.
